Output c22895032b2fddc85b143f48a36d356841eef827ea97ed8b7b494f66a9d52b24:20

value
305948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5352a093bc9f3c80f38e287e06031f886f0920bf OP_EQUAL
address
39HazWR1Vh6JCdZegcXXf6kkQThB5GrhSB
transaction
c22895032b2fddc85b143f48a36d356841eef827ea97ed8b7b494f66a9d52b24
spent
true